Transaction 5dafa74ee9620237d7bc008a38e750b7cd86ec45b504ae93077b45d63a69bf2e
1 Input
1 Output
-
5dafa74ee9620237d7bc008a38e750b7cd86ec45b504ae93077b45d63a69bf2e:0
- value
- 524301
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ff5562b89ff86caa3eafc61aa202a57de0b777e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H3P9rfTvjiavTmvgXYMVaS2MXd7h6UQG8